Biography

2021-22: Continued to do a lot of the little things that didn’t necessarily show up in a box score to help the Ramblers to another NCAA Tournament appearance … Played in all 33 contests and started 11 games, including each of the final 10 contests, and averaged 5.6 points, 4.4 rebounds, 1.2 assists and 0.9 steals per game … Drained 48.2 percent (68-for-141) of his field goal tries and 39.4 percent (28-for-71) of his shots from long distance … Came off the bench in the season opener to account for eight points, three assists and a career-high 10 rebounds in only 20 minutes of play versus Coppin State (Nov. 9) … Scored 12 points in a win against Florida Gulf Coast (Nov. 13) … Through the first four outings of the year, contributed 8.3 ppg, 7.0 rpg and 1.3 apg ... Had eight points, eight boards and two steals against UIC (Nov. 20) … Accumulated six caroms, four steals and three assists against Michigan State (Nov. 24) at the Battle 4 Atlantis … In his first start of the season, produced a season-high 14 points, six assists, four steals and four rebounds in a victory over Roosevelt (Dec. 7) … Tallied 13 points off the bench in wins over Valparaiso (Jan. 11) and at Missouri State (Feb. 6) … Had seven points and eight boards in only 18 minutes at Evansville (Jan. 18) … Produced 11 points, five rebounds and a pair of thefts at Valparaiso (Feb. 16) … Contributed 11 points, seven rebounds and two steals at Illinois State (Feb. 2) … Had at least one steal in 10 consecutive games, February 9 through March 6 … Converted 34 of his final 61 (.557) shots from the field … Loyola was 6-0 when he scored in double digits … Honorable Mention MVC Scholar-Athlete Team selection.
 
2020-21: Starter in the first 11 games of the year before becoming a weapon off the bench and providing innumerable intangible plays for the duration of the season … In 31 appearances overall, contributed 6.5 points, 3.3 rebounds, 1.8 assists and 0.6 steals per game … Scored in double figures nine times, with Loyola going 8-1 in those contests … Reached double digits in five of the first eight outings, including a 17-point performance in the season opener versus Lewis (Dec. 5) … Provided 15 points, four boards, three assists and a pair of steals in 22 minutes of play against Chicago Sate (Dec. 9) … Racked up 16 points, five rebounds and four helpers against Illinois State (Dec. 28) … Gave the team a major lift in his first game coming off the bench by scoring a season-high 24 points, while adding three boards, three assists and two steals in a victory over Northern Iowa (Jan. 16) … Scored in double figures in each of his first four games off the bench, becoming the first Rambler to come off the bench and score 10 or more points in four straight  outings since Aundre Jackson in 2016-17 … Closed out the weekend series with Northern Iowa (Jan. 17) by pitching in 13 points, three caroms and a season-high six assists … Scored 11 points in a win at Bradley (Jan. 24) … Posted nine points, three rebounds and a pair of dimes in a rout of Drake (Feb. 13) … Won a battle for a loose ball that led to a key basket in the win over Drake in the MVC Championship (March 7) … MVC Scholar-Athlete First Team and Division I-AAA Scholar-Athlete Team selection…. Member of the MVC Honor Roll.
 
2019-20: Quickly asserted himself as one of the top players in the Missouri Valley Conference, earning Third Team All-MVC and MVC All-Newcomer designation after consistently stuffing the boxscore … Ranked second on the team in points (12.7), rebounds (3.9), assists (2.2) and steals (1.5) per game, and connected on 47.8 percent (141-for-295) of his field goal attempts, including 42.6 percent (58-for-136) of his treys … His scoring average of 12.7 ppg ranked 12th overall in The Valley and was third among newcomers to the league … Ranked fourth in the MVC in three-point field goal percentage (.426) and tied for third in steals (1.5 spg) … Finished with the highest scoring average by a Loyola newcomer since Aundre Jackson in 2016-17 (14.1 ppg) … Scored 20 or more points six times, the most by a newcomer since Jackson in 2016-17 (6) … Loyola was 16-6 when he tallied 10 or more points … Burst onto the scene by providing 14 points, a season-high nine rebounds, four steals and three assists in the season-opening win against UC Davis (Nov. 5) … Notched the first of his 20-point efforts when he scored 23 points and kicked in six rebounds, two assists, a pair of steals and a block versus Coppin State (Nov. 12) … Went for 16 points, seven boards and four steals in a rout of Saint Joseph’s (Nov. 16) … Delivered back-to-back performances with 20+ points at the Cayman Islands Classic, registering 22 points, five boards and five helpers against Colorado State (Nov. 26) before racking up 21 points versus Old Dominion (Nov. 27) … Those games began s stretch that saw Hall score 20+ tallies three times in five contests, capping that run with 21 points, five rebounds a season-best five steals and two dimes against Norfolk State (Dec. 15) … Scored in double digits in four consecutive games on four different occasions in 2019-20 … Tossed in 16 points in a victory over Vanderbilt (Dec. 18) … Recorded 16 points, five boards and four assists in a victory over Southern Illinois (Jan., 16), then accounted for 17 points, five caroms and three dimes at Illinois State (Jan. 19) … Was nearly perfect from the field in a rout of Indiana State (Jan. 22), as he delivered 23 points, going 9-for-10 from the field, knocking down all five of his threes … In an overtime victory over Northern Iowa (Feb. 15), he had 11 points, five rebounds, a season-best six assists and no turnovers … Torched Illinois State (Feb. 19) for a season-high 28 points, going 11-for-14 from the field, and added five rebounds, three assists and a pair of thefts … Those 28 points were the most by a Rambler newcomer since Milton Doyle went for 28 against Northern Iowa on January 14, 2014 … After converting only 5 of his first 18 (.278) tries from behind the arc, converted 53 of his final 118 (.449) triples, including 27 of his final 59 (.458) … Named MVC Scholar-Athlete Second Team … Member of the MVC Honor Roll.
 
2018-19: Per NCAA rules, sat out the season after transferring from the University of Indianapolis … Member of the MVC Honor Roll and also picked up the MVC Commissioner’s Academic Excellence Award.
 
2017-18 (at Indianapolis): First Team All-Great Lakes Valley Conference selection after averaging team highs of 14.8 ppg and 5.6 rpg to go with 2.2 apg and 1.0 spg … Ranked 44th in NCAA Division II after draining 56 percent (153-for-273) of his field goal attempts and also connected on 43.6 percent (34-for-78) of his three-point tries … In GLVC action, accounted for 16.9 ppg and 5.9 rpg … Tabbed GLVC Player of the Week on February 19 after tallying 29.0 ppg and 11.5 rpg in a pair of road wins … Scored in double figures on 23 occasions, including a streak of 14 consecutive games, January 4 through February 22 … Poured in a career-best 31 points, on 13-of-16 shooting, at William Jewell (Feb. 17) … Scored 20 or more points seven times, including in three straight outings, January 13-20 … Hauled in double-digit rebounds on four occasions, including a season-high 12 in a 27-point, 12-rebound performance at Missouri S&T (Feb. 15) … Registered three double-doubles … Posted a season-best six steals and added 18 points against Bluefield State (Dec. 14) … Named CoSIDA Academic All-District IV.
 
2016-17 (at Indianapolis): Became just the third player in program history to take home GLVC Freshman of the Year accolades after averaging 10.3 ppg and 4.1 rpg … Also named to the GLVC All-Freshman Team … In his first career start, accounted for 12 points and three boards against Lake Erie (Nov. 13) as he became the first true freshman to start for UIndy since the 2012-13 campaign … Scored in double figures 13 times, topping the 20-point plateau on a pair of occasions… Recorded a season-high 24 points and equaled a season best with seven boards at Saint Joseph’s (Feb. 23).
 
High School: Four-year letterwinner in basketball and also collected two letters in baseball at Greenfield-Central High School … Three-time All-Hoosier Heritage Conference and All-Hancock County selection … Named Large School All-State by the Indiana Basketball Coaches Association as a senior after putting up 18.3 ppg, 7.8 rpg, 2.1 apg and 1.2 spg … Averaged 16.3 ppg and 5.5 rpg in his varsity career … Excelled in the classroom, earning a 3.9 grade-point average, while graduating in the top 12 percent of his class … Member of the National Honor Society.
